Ответы на вопрос » образование » Каким наименьшим количеством двоичных знаков закодировать слово КОЛОКОЛ?
                                 
Задавайте вопросы и получайте ответы от участников сайта и специалистов своего дела.
Отвечайте на вопросы и помогайте людям узнать верный ответ на поставленный вопрос.
Начните зарабатывать $ на сайте. Задавайте вопросы и отвечайте на них.
Закрыть меню
Вопросы без Ответа Радио


Каким наименьшим количеством двоичных знаков закодировать слово КОЛОКОЛ?


опубликовал 23-09-2024, 15:51
Каким наименьшим количеством двоичных знаков закодировать слово КОЛОКОЛ?

🤑 Заработай в Телеграм на Топовых крипто играх 🤑

🌀 - Заработать в NOT Pixel (От создателей NOT Coin), начни рисовать NFT картину всем миром и получи крипту по итогам (заходим раз в 8 часов, рисуем пиксели нужного цвета и майним монету)

✳ - Заработать в Blum до листинга и получить подарки, начни играть в Blum и получи крипту бесплатно (главное сбивать звезды, выполнять задания)

🔥 - Заработать в Hot (HereWallet) и получить подарки, начни майнить крипту в телефоне бесплатно (выполнять задания, увеличивать уровень майнинга, получать крипту и радоваться)



Ответы на вопрос:

  1. Гена
    Gena 30 сентября 2024 16:14

    отзыв нравится 0 отзыв не нравится

    Для эффективного кодирования слова "КОЛОКОЛ" с использованием двоичного кода по условию Фано, необходимо проанализировать входящие данные и рассчитать требуемое количество двоичных знаков. Вот план действий:

    ### 1. Анализ входных данных
    - Слово: КОЛОКОЛ
    - Буквы: А, Б, В, К, О, Л
    - Известные кодовые слова:
      - А – 110
      - Б – 01
      - В – 000

    ### 2. Число повторений букв в слове
    Чтобы оценить общее количество двоичных знаков, необходимо узнать, сколько раз каждая буква встречается в слове "КОЛОКОЛ":
    - К: 2 раза
    - О: 3 раза
    - Л: 2 раза

    Таким образом, у нас есть:
    - Две буквы К
    - Три буквы О
    - Две буквы Л

    ### 3. Подбор кодов для букв
    Условие Фано требует, чтобы мы подобрали коды для оставшихся букв (К, О, Л) так, чтобы ни одно кодовое слово не было началом другого. Выбираем коды для букв, используя краткие двоичные последовательности.

    - Варианты для выбора (на данный момент: 110, 01, 000):
      - Выберем для К и О коды, которые не пересекаются с уже известными:
        - К: 10 (предполагаем, еще не известно)
        - О: 111 (предполагаем, еще не известно)
        - Л: 01 (но Л уже закодирован, выберем 01 для Б)

    Получим следующее кодирование:
    - К: 10
    - О: 111
    - Л: 01

    Таким образом:
    - Б: 01
    - В: 000
    - А: 110

    ### 4. Подсчет двоичных знаков
    Кодируем слово "КОЛОКОЛ":
    - К: 10 (первое К)
    - О: 111 (первое О)
    - Л: 01 (Л)
    - О: 111 (второе О)
    - К: 10 (второе К)
    - О: 111 (третье О)
    - Л: 01 (второе Л)

    Теперь подсчитаем общее количество двоичных знаков:
    - К: 10 – 2 знака
    - О: 111 – 3 знака
    - Л: 01 – 2 знака
    - О: 111 – 3 знака
    - К: 10 – 2 знака
    - О: 111 – 3 знака
    - Л: 01 – 2 знака

    Формула:
    \( 2 (К) + 3 (О) + 2 (Л) + 3 (О) + 2 (К) + 3 (О) + 2 (Л) = 2 + 3 + 2 + 3 + 2 + 3 + 2 = 17 знаков \)

    ### 5. Итог
    Наименьшее количество двоичных знаков, необходимое для кодирования слова "КОЛОКОЛ", составит **17**. 

    ### Резюме
    - Анализ частоты букв помог в выборе оптимальных кодов.
    - Использование правила Фано обеспечило уникальность кодов.
    - Подсчет знаков позволил получить окончательное число, необходимое для передачи сообщения.

    Ссылка на ответ | Все вопросы
    30
    09
Добавить ответ
Ваше Имя:
Ваш E-Mail:
Введите два слова, показанных на изображении: *




Показать все вопросы без ответов >>